How much do associate recruiter j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for associate recruiter in Boca Raton, FL is $46,078.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$41,800.00 and $50,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ges an Associate Recruiter might face during the candidate sourcing process?

Associate Recruiters often encounter challenges such as finding qualified candidates in a competitive market, managing high volumes of applications, and ensuring a positive candidate experience throughout the process. They may also need to quickly adapt to changing hiring needs and prioritize multiple open roles at once. Building strong communication with hiring managers and maintaining organized tracking of candidates are key strategies to overcome these obstacles.

The main difference between an Associate Recruiter and a Recruiter lies in experience and responsibilities. Associate Recruiters are typically entry-level, supporting senior recruiters and focusing on initial candidate sourcing. Recruiters usually have more experience, handle full-cycle recruiting, and interact directly with clients and candidates. Both roles are essential in the hiring process, but the Recruiter role generally involves greater independence and responsibility.

What are Associate Recruiters?

Associate Recruiters are entry-level professionals who assist in the recruitment process within organizations or staffing agencies. Their main responsibilities include sourcing candidates, screening resumes, conducting initial interviews, and coordinating with hiring managers. They support senior recruiters and help ensure that the hiring process runs smoothly by managing administrative tasks and maintaining candidate databases. Associate Recruiters play a key role in identifying and attracting top talent to meet an organization's staffing needs.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Associate Recruiter, and why are they important?

To excel as an Associate Recruiter, you need strong interpersonal skills, a basic understanding of talent acquisition processes, and at least a bachelor's degree in human resources or a related field. Familiarity with applicant tracking systems (ATS), LinkedIn Recruiter, and sourcing platforms is commonly required. Excellent communication, organization, and the ability to build relationships help differentiate top performers in this role. These skills are vital to efficiently attract, assess, and engage qualified candidates, ensuring successful hires for the organization.
